For the garden planner

If you’re a gardener, then you know that planning and preparing your garden are important steps in making sure everything grows well. You may have already planned out the layout of your garden, but every year it can be useful to look at what worked and didn’t work from last year.

The best way to start is by checking how much sun each area gets during the growing season. This can be done with online tools or apps like this one: https://calculator.sunnycalc.com/sun-hours-in-australia/. If there’s not enough sunlight in an area then consider moving some plants around or adding more artificial light (such as grow lights).
